Sam’s Bath
A fun story that teaches children to ask before they take people's things.
This story would be a great way to test your problem solving and prediction skills. Sam doesn’t have a bath in his house so how can he make himself clean. Why are the animals looking at him like that on the cover?
Title: Sam’s Bath
Author: Ali Foster
Illustrator: Nikki Slade Robinson
Publisher: Duck Creek Press
ISBN: 9781927305683
RRP: $19.99
Format: paperback
Publication: September 2021
Ages: 4+
Themes: Country life, Respect for others
Do you have any advisory warnings for this book? Partial nudity (in context, Sam’s in the bath)
Would this book work as a read aloud? Yes
Is there a particular part of the country that it’s set in? rural or semi-rural
Reviewer: Leanne Nathan, Associate Principal, Clendon Park School, Auckland
How are you recommending this book? Recommended
Opening sentence: Sam lived at the end of a quiet country road.
